  4/5  Posted by MR. KRYZHKO, Igor, Russia in November 2008
"The hotel is not brand new but the overview from the window is awsome! Make sure you specify that you want window overlooking Sumida River or Rainbow Bridge, when making the order. You may also choose city view and enjoy Tokyo tower view then. We have stayed in this hotel for three times already and each time there is the same complain, staff should improve their English. Sometimes it is really difficult to explain even very simple things. But at the same time they are helpful and try to do their best to help you even if they don't understand a word. "
  4/5  Posted by MS. THOMSON, jean, United States in November 2008
"The staff was very helpful. The location was perfect for visiting Tsukiji fish market - only a few minute walk away. It was also convenient for walking to the Ginza. We also walked to the Imperial Palace from the hotel. The views from the hotel were stunning and we enjoyed being right on the Sumida River with its beautiful strolling path. The massage chair in the hotel room was an extra bonus. The breakfast was plentiful and good. Our only complaint was runny eggs which is not unusual in Japan."
  4/5  Posted by MR. Ivan, Spain in April 2008
"We had very nice time at hotel new hankyu. Its location is perfect for as. Outside of the crowd but very near to Tsukiji metro station (about 5 min walking) two stops to Ginza station and the main shopping area (also you can go walking about 15 min). The room was good, clean and have very nice view at the high floors. The staff was helpful and there is a gym next to the hotel (it is not included and quite expensive for the visitors)."

  4/5  Posted by MR. COOK, Andrew, Australia in February 2008
"My family and I stayed at the hotel in January. The hotel itself is beautiful and in a very scenic position. Unfortunatly it was not a good position for us as I thought we were near the train station. We were travelling on a Japan Rail Pass so it meant a $15.00 taxi ride to the station. The Tepinyaki resteraunt was fantastic (very expensive though) Great views from the Breakfast resteraunt. It was a shame that the hotel is advertised with lots of amenities which are actually next door and you have to pay each time you want to use them. (this seems to be the norm for Japan) The massage chairs in the rooms made up for everything!!!! The staff have been most helpful..... I left a piece of Art in the foyer when we were leaving. Due to our flight I could not go back and get it. After help from an employee at the train station they located it and sent it via Fedex to my home in Australia..."

  5/5  Posted by MR. LU, Stephen, Australia in November 2007
"We have a fantastic stay at New Hankyu Hotel. It is a boutique hotel with less than 100 rooms. The hotel starts from Level 33 to 38. The views to the Tokyo city skyline & the River are just awesome. It is 5 min walk to the Tsukiji subway station. And it is especially close to the famous Tsukiji fish market to see the tuna auctions at 5:30am with just 5 min walk. The room is spacious, the bed is very comfortable & solid, & we enjoyed the massage chair very much at the end of the day.
